Father’s Day 2024: 6 Creative Ways to Celebrate Dad at the Office!

Fathers play a vital role in shaping our lives and offering unwavering support. Whether they’re cheering us on from the sidelines, offering sage advice or simply making us laugh with their corny jokes, dads hold a special place in our hearts. To honour these incredible men, Father’s Day is a special occasion observed globally on the third Sunday of June every year. This day, honour, acknowledge, and recognise fathers and father figures for their love, support, and sacrifices. This year, Father’s Day falls on June 16.

As Father’s Day approaches, it’s a perfect moment for employers and HR teams to shed a light on the dads and father figures in the workplace. By recognising their efforts, the day can boost team spirit and morale and create a meaningful and memorable celebration for all fathers contributing in their offices or workplaces.

So, this Father’s Day, let’s take a moment to celebrate the amazing dads, grandfathers, and father figures. Here are some creative ideas for celebrating the special day at your workplace.

Father’s Day 2024: Tips to Celebrate Dad at the Office!

  1. Breakfast or lunch celebrationTreat the dads in the office to a traditional Indian breakfast or lunch, featuring regional favourites and freshly brewed coffee or tea. This culturally rich celebration can be a simple way to show appreciation and allow them to connect with colleagues in a joyful and relaxed setting.
  2. Dress Down for DadsLighten the mood with a casual dress code for the day. This can be a fun way to show the dads in the office that you support their busy schedule and appreciate their work-life balance.
  3. Recognition and AppreciationTake a moment during a team meeting or gathering to acknowledge all the father figures in your workplace for their hard work, dedication, and contributions to the team. This simple gesture can make fathers feel valued and appreciated in the workplace.
  4. Father’s Day-themed PotluckEncourage employees to bring in their favourite homemade dish or treats associated with their dads. It is a fun way to share cultural traditions and enjoy a variety of delicious foods together. Organise a theme for the potluck, like Father’s Favourite Recipes, for a personal touch.
  5. Family DayConsider organising a special day where employees can bring their families to the workplace for a fun-filled celebration. Plan activities such as crafts, games, a dance challenge, or a barbecue for the dads to do with their children and create a cheerful atmosphere. This can be a great opportunity for colleagues to create lasting memories with one another’s families.
  6. Gift Of GratitudeIt’s not easy to be a full-time employee and a full-time parent! Express gratitude and support your coworkers by giving them a small token of love, like a personalised dad-sized mug, a gift basket with snacks for dads, or a snack counter.
